Transaction 0866255b3e23073c5f2456ee0ce82fa661e3314c600dd00cde105d02c2bb944c
1 Input
1 Output
-
0866255b3e23073c5f2456ee0ce82fa661e3314c600dd00cde105d02c2bb944c: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c8c73551abad65a97c34c41a972985d7b30082185cffeb7566a15254ce4a3fcc
- address
- bc1perrn25dt44j6jlp5csdfw2v967espqsctnl7katx59f9fnj28lxqfk7ru5